Building Community Art Capacity in Tennessee

GrantID: 59135

Grant Funding Amount Low: $500

Deadline: February 1, 2024

Grant Amount High: $500

Grant Overview

Capacity Gaps Addressed by Tennessee Rural Art Grants

The Tennessee Rural Art Grants program aims to address the significant capacity gaps faced by artists in rural Tennessee. With over 50% of Tennessee’s land area designated as rural, artists in these communities often confront substantial challenges, including limited access to resources, grants, and networks that urban artists frequently benefit from. The initiative seeks to bridge these gaps by providing targeted funding specifically designed for artists operating within rural landscapes, enhancing their ability to produce community-focused art projects.

In Tennessee, the rural arts sector has long struggled due to insufficient infrastructure and support mechanisms. Many rural communities lack dedicated art spaces and local funding opportunities, putting artists at a disadvantage compared to their urban counterparts. This disparity emphasizes the need for initiatives that recognize and respond to the unique challenges posed by rural living, allowing artists to thrive regardless of their geographical circumstances.

Readiness Requirements for Project Implementation

To participate in the Tennessee Rural Art Grants program, applicants will need to demonstrate readiness through a clear project proposal that outlines the artistic vision and community impact. This includes providing a detailed budget, a timeline for project implementation, and identification of collaborative partners within the community. The program aims to ensure that artists are not only ready to create art but also engaged in fostering community participation.

Additionally, successful projects will necessitate regular reporting and assessment to evaluate their impact on the community. This tracking will help identify best practices and learning opportunities, fostering a continuous cycle of improvement within Tennessee's rural arts landscape.
